WTCI Celebrates The Memory Of Legendary Coach Pat Summit In "The A List With Alison Lebovitz" Broadcast Thursday At 8 P.M.

  • Thursday, June 30, 2016
WTCI will present an encore broadcast of “The A List with Alison Lebovitz” featuring the legendary basketball coach Pat Summitt on Thursday at 8 p.m.  This episode originally aired in 2010, prior to Summitt’s Alzheimer’s diagnosis and is a lively conversation with the legendary NCAA coach about her career and life. 
 
Ms. Lebovitz asked Coach Summitt about the placard in her locker room that read, ‘Perfection is our goal. Excellence will be tolerated.’  Recalling the episode, Ms.
Lebovitz said, “She didn't deny it. She also tried to teach me how to master her infamous 'stare' and was quick to remind me that it's only effective when you don't talk. Such a fitting lesson from a woman whose parting leaves so many of us speechless today. May her memory forever be a blessing.”
 
"The A List with Alison Lebovitz" is a one-on-one weekly interview series that features local and national personalities.  Hosted by Ms. Lebovitz, this series is entering its eighth season and has featured both local and national celebrities, including Ken Burns, Ben Vereen and Senator Bob Corker.
